Sending signals from MIX channels and STEREO/MONO channels to MATRIX buses Sending signals from MIX channels and STEREO/MONO channels to MATRIX buses This section explains how to send the signal from a MIX or STEREO/MONO channel to MATRIX buses 1-8. You can do this in either of the following two ways. ■ Using the SELECTED CHANNEL section In this method, you use the encoders of the SELECTED CHANNEL section to adjust the send levels to the MATRIX buses. This method allows you to simultaneously control the signals sent from a specific MIX, STEREO (L/R), or MONO (C) channel to all MATRIX buses. ■ Using the Centralogic section In this method, you use the multifunction encoders of the Centralogic section to adjust the send levels to the MATRIX buses. This method allows you to simultaneously control the signals sent from up to eight MIX, STEREO (L/R), or MONO (C) channels to a specific MATRIX bus. 6 Output channel operations Using the SELECTED CHANNEL section Use the encoders of the SELECTED CHANNEL section to adjust the send level of the signals sent from the desired MIX, STEREO (L/R) or MONO (C) channel to all MATRIX buses. 1 Make sure that an output port is assigned to the MATRIX bus to which you want to send signals, and that an external device is connected. For details on assigning an output port to a MATRIX bus refer to p. 105. For details on connecting an external device, refer to p. 46. 2 Using the navigation keys, assign the desired MIX channels 1-8 or 9-16 or the STEREO/MONO channels to the Centralogic section. 3 Use the [SEL] keys of the Centralogic section to select the input channel that will send signals to the MATRIX buses. The STEREO/MONO channels can also be selected directly by using the [SEL] keys of the STEREO/ MONO MASTER section. 4 Press any one of the encoders of the SELECTED CHANNEL section to access the SELECTED CHANNEL VIEW screen. The SELECTED CHANNEL VIEW screen will show all the mix parameters of the corresponding channel. Adjustments of send levels to the MATRIX buses is done in the TO MATRIX field of this screen. 21 3 1 TO MATRIX field In this field you can switch the on/off status and adjust the level of the signal sent from that channel to the MATRIX buses. B TO MATRIX SEND LEVEL knob This adjusts the send level of the signal sent from that channel to the MATRIX buses. To adjust the send levels, use the encoders of the SELECTED CHANNEL section. If the send-destination MATRIX bus is set to stereo, the left knob of the two adjacent knobs will operate as a PAN knob (for the STEREO channel or a stereo MIX channel, the BALANCE knob). If the TO MATRIX SEND ON/OFF button (3) is off, the knob will be dimmed. C TO MATRIX SEND ON/OFF button Functions as an on/off switch for the signal sent from that channel to the MATRIX bus. An indication of "PRE" in black characters on a white background is shown above these buttons only if the signal send position is PRE (pre-fader). This indication is not shown for POST (post-fader). (For details on how to switch between PRE and POST → p. 87). HINT • If PRE is selected as the position from which the signal is sent to a MATRIX bus, the signal will be sent from the pre-fader position regardless of the setting in the BUS SETUP screen.
